Program Description

Students must have received their CCNA Certification or have completed the courses in the Cisco CCNA Specialist technical certificate program.

The Cisco CCNP Specialist certificate program is designed to prepare the experienced LAN & WAN technician to take the four Cisco Certified Networking Professional (CCNP) exams. In addition to preparing students for the exams, the curriculum provides the skill sets preparation that will enable students to perform associated tasks. High school graduation or GED is required for admission to this program.

Employment Opportunities

According to the Information Technology Association of America (ITAA) employers will create a demand in this country for roughly 1.6 million IT workers this year. With demand for appropriately skilled people far exceeding supply, half of these positions will likely go unfilled. In a total U.S. IT workforce of 10 million, that shortfall means one job in every dozen will be vacant.

Curriculum Outline Credits
Occupational Courses 24
CIS 2501 Building Scalable CISCO Networks 6
CIS 2502 Building CISCO Remote Access Networks 6
CIS 2503 Building CISCO Multilayer Switched Networks 6
CIS 2504 CISCO Internetworking Troubleshooting 6

Notes:

  • A grade of “C” or higher is required for all courses with the prefixes CIS.
